get Exhaust temp. it helps you to read if ur running lean or rich. or u can get a/f ration guage, but they usually work better w/ a wide band O2 sensor. i find either one of those to be a great 3rd most important guage.

anyway i used gunk engine cleaner, sit for 2-3 mins...hose it off and spray the engine down with tire foam...close the hood and start/run the car until engines warm...
